WebJan 27, 2024 · add_compile_options ($<$:-fopt-info-vec -fopt-info-loop>) then it’s wrong, because a genex must be a single argument: for CMake, it’s just a string until generate time, and must survive as an intact string until then. So spaces in it require quoting (if you want them to appear as spaces), and lists (which … WebFeb 21, 2024 · CMake can set compiler flags that encompass three broad scopes. We set global and per-language options near the beginning of the top-level CMakeLists.txt, before any targets are declared, to avoid confusion about scope. COMPILE_DEFINITIONS works in a similar fashion. By default, add_compile_options () is global for all languages.
Ubuntu Manpage: cmake-commands - CMake Language Command Reference
WebThe final set of compile or link options used for a target is constructed by accumulating options from the current target and the usage requirements of its dependencies. The … WebDec 24, 2024 · 3. Inspecting the Default Build Types. This section will focus on inspecting build types and their corresponding compiler flags. The CMake BUILD_TYPE variable specifies which build type configuration is selected at build time, and is empty by default. When a build type is not selected for a project, the compiler will only receive flags … playboy hard rock cafe
Set Definitions for external sub directory - CMake Discourse
WebNov 24, 2024 · CMAKE_CXX_FLAGSやtarget_compile_optionsに-std=c++11を加えない. CMAKE_CXX_STANDARD(CMake 3.1以降)を使うか、target_compile_features … WebMay 1, 2024 · It’s messy, which is why the CMake 3.13 behavior is more intuitive (option() uses non-cache variable if it exists and doesn’t even create a cache variable). If relying on CMake 3.13 behavior, the project should ensure it sets its minimum CMake version requirement accordingly (i.e. cmake_minimum_required(VERSION 3.13) or similar). WebCMake中的add_compile_options命令用于向源文件的编译添加选项,其格式如下:. add_compile_options( ...)? ? ? 将选项添加到COMPILE_OPTIONS目录属性。从当前目录及以下目录编译target时,将使用这些选项。 primary care hyponatraemia